It was changed to "in combat only" because players on PC had it equipped, chugged a potion, and then put on another offensive set through add-ons. Then ganked.
NMA is very similar in power to CA so the ganking aspect of the set is no longer the issue. It's the power of add-ons that prevents this set from reverting.

Just comparing the two:
NMA: 610 WD/SD from bonuses
CA: 790 WD/SD from bonuses
That 30% is absolutely correct on it's own, but NMA also has 1487 penetration.
I'm not sure the conversion from penetration to WD/SD but it definitely brings the two closer than 30% when you look at it from a ganking perspective.
